Sicilian Lentil Pasta Sauce

Bring the flavors of Sicily to your table with this hearty and wholesome Sicilian Lentil Pasta Sauce. Bursting with Mediterranean-inspired ingredients like tender lentils, fragrant garlic, sweet carrots, and fresh basil, this vegan pasta sauce is both comforting and nutrient-packed. Slow-simmered canned tomatoes and a dash of oregano create a rich, savory base, while a hint of crushed red pepper adds an optional kick. Perfectly paired with spaghetti, penne, or fusilli, this sauce comes together in just under an hour, making it a fantastic weeknight dinner option. Garnish with vegan Parmesan for an extra indulgent touch and savor every bite of this plant-based Italian classic.

🥘 Ingredients

16 items
  • 3 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1 medium Yellow onion, diced
  • 4 cloves Gar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 large Carrot, finely diced
  • 1 stalk Celery stalk, finely diced
  • 1 can Canned whole peeled tomatoes (28 oz)
  • 1.5 cups Cooked lentils
  • 1 cup Vegetable broth
  • 2 tablespoons Tomato paste
  • 1 teaspoon Dried oregano
  • 0.25 teaspoons Crushed red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oons Black pepper
  • 0.25 cup Fresh basil leaves, chopped
  • 12 oz Pasta (spaghetti, penne, or fusilli)
  • 0.25 cup Grated vegan Parmesan (optional)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Heat the olive oil in a large saucepan or Dutch oven over medium heat.

2

Add the diced onion and sauté for 3-4 minutes until softened and translucent.

3

Stir in the minced garlic, diced carrot, and diced celery. Cook for another 5 minutes, stirring frequently, until the vegetables begin to soften.

4

Add the canned whole peeled tomatoes, breaking them up with a wooden spoon or spatula. Stir well to combine.

5

Add the cooked lentils, vegetable broth, tomato paste, dried oregano, crushed red pepper flakes (if using), salt, and black pepper. Stir to combine all ingredients.

6

Bring the sauce to a gentle simmer, then reduce the heat to low. Cover and let it cook for 25-30 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the sauce thickens and the flavors meld together.

7

While the sauce is simmering, cook the pasta according to the package directions in a large pot of salted boiling water. Reserve 1/2 cup of the pasta cooking water before draining.

8

Once the sauce is done, taste and adjust seasoning with additional salt or pepper if needed.

9

Stir in the fresh basil and mix well. If the sauce is too thick, add a splash of the reserved pasta cooking water to reach your desired consistency.

10

Serve the sauce over your cooked pasta. Garnish with grated vegan Parmesan, if desired.
